Latest Patents
Wakizaka's recent patents showcase his expertise in developing advanced oxygen sensors. His "Solid Pole Oxygen Sensor" patent features a solid pole wherein a lead wire of platinum or platinum rhodium is securely encased by a solid electrolyte and shaped into a circular plate. This design undergoes a drying and firing process in a reducing atmosphere, creating a platinum electrode that effectively integrates with a cylindrical ceramic insulator. This innovation allows for a reliable and efficient measurement of oxygen levels.
Additionally, he holds a patent for a "Method of Manufacturing Oxygen Sensing Element." This element is designed to accurately measure partial pressures of oxygen within sample gases. It involves a solid electrolyte member embedded with a reference oxygen partial pressure means, made from a finely divided metal or metal-metal oxide mixture. The meticulous compression molding of these materials underscores Wakizaka's dedication to refining oxygen sensing technologies.
